Ladybirds Do Not Go to Day Careis aspirited, funny and empowering picture book toencourage even the most nervous of children to spread their wings and try something new.
Mum says its the first day of day care, but Ravis dressed up as his favourite insect, and he is quite certain that ladybirds donotgo to day care. In fact, this ladybird would rather stay home and eat aphids, thank you very much!
Can an anxious and unsure Ravi find the bravery he needs to take flight?
